Money Transfer to Pakistan: Best Options & Fees
Sending funds to Pakistan has become easier than ever, with a range of options available. Popular choices include Western Union, MoneyGram, Xoom (by copyright), and Wise (formerly TransferWise), alongside local bank shipments. Western Union and MoneyGram are commonly accessible with large agent networks, but often carry higher fees and poorer exchange rates. Xoom offers a balance of convenience and competitive pricing, particularly for smaller amounts. Wise typically provides the most exchange rates, though reach might be less widespread compared to the major players. Think about comparing the total cost, including both transfer charges and exchange values, before submitting your transaction. Remember to also check for any possible restrictions on transfer sums.

How to Remit Cash to Pakistan – Step by Step Breakdown
Do you want to send funds to Pakistan? Below is a straightforward process to assist you through the process. First, pick a reputable money transfer service like MoneyGram or others; review their rates and pricing. Next, create an profile with the preferred service . You need to submit verification such as your ID . Then , specify the beneficiary's details and bank account in Pakistan. To finish, pay for the transfer using your debit card or another supported payment method . Remember to sending limits may apply .
PK Cash Remittance : Rates , Duration & Trustworthiness
Sending cash to Pakistan can be a worry for many. Understanding the rates , delivery of the remittance , and overall trustworthiness of the service is vital. Several choices are available, each with unique prices. Traditional methods like bank transfers often have higher charges , but can offer greater protection . Online remittance services frequently boast competitive costs and faster processing schedules. Trustworthiness also plays a vital role; check companies with strong reviews and a proven history . Here's a quick overview:
- Typical Charges: Varies greatly, from 1% to 5% depending on the method .
- Arrival Time : Can be immediate for electronic transfers, or take 1 to 3 working days for traditional transfers.
- Elements Influencing Costs: Exchange rate , amount being remitted, and payment type used.
Always check multiple providers before making a choice to ensure you're getting the most advantageous rate and a reliable remittance process .
